Hellen and Shana run their own business. Every Friday they take two gas grills and grill burgers in front of the Unilus Leopards Campus hall. Working from noon till 6pm, they are able to serve 250 hungry students. They are both equally good in what they are doing, so their wages are equal.
One day Shana was not feeling well, so Hellen had to go there alone. Of course, she has chosen to use only one grill. Within the same period of time she was able to serve 120 customers.
- What has happened to the average cost of each burger? Show your work.
- b. What can be said about the returns to scale for their business? Explain.
